Brand Architecture: Understanding the Architecture
(continued)
In the past, many Businesses have promoted and sold their
Solution Platforms as part of the GE Brand architecture, e.g.,
"GE Perfect Getaways" or "GE Polymershapes". Under our new
brand architecture, these names must be conveyed in Level
4 without the lock-up to "GE". However, it is known that DR
marketers must balance acknowledgement and growth of the
primary GE Brand with existing sales targets and expected results
from sub-businesses, sub-brands or product solutions already
known to customers.
Therefore, on the front side of direct response applications, you
have the fl exibility of promoting the sub-business, sub-brand
or Solution Platform at the Level 4 architecture level without
the traditional architecture lock-up. This should be done along
with elements that further describe or illustrate the off er in an
inspirational and contemporary way. Sub-businesses, sub-brands
or Solution Platforms are always "brought to you by GE" or "by GE"
and should always be communicated as such to ensure the target
can associate GE to the off er. Under these circumstances, the
proper brand architecture must then be displayed appropriately
on the back side of the component.
